# Corvale Series Pricing (Managers Only)

The Corvale line moves to tiered pricing next quarter. Standard tier stays flat; Plus and Premier rise 6% and 9% respectively. Discounts above 15% now require sign-off from Dana Ferrick. Department heads should brief account leads before the change takes effect. The confidential planning note follows below.

internal memo for hahaf-kahof: Only 39 of the 428 pilot accounts renewed Sorion, so a churn review is set for April 12. Praokix Freight is in early talks to buy Queniusox Group for about $145.8 million.

Migration Step 4: Enforce the order-cutoff rule

Crumbhaven's bakery platform rejects new orders after 14:00 local time for next-day delivery. During migration, backfill the cutoff_at column on legacy orders before enabling the trigger, or the validator will void open carts. Run the backfill script once, then flip the feature flag. The script reads its target from the connection string directly below this step.

warehouse DSN: mssql://belion_svc:6e@db-785f.paliqworks.corp:5432/ulaax

Alert: SnapGrid snapshot-test failure rate above threshold on the Plumage UI component suite. This fires when more than 15% of component snapshots diverge from baseline within a single CI run, usually indicating an unintentional visual regression or a stale baseline after a design-token update in Featherkit. Check whether the diff cluster maps to one component family; if so, a token bump is the likely cause and baselines can be regenerated. Triage steps and the regeneration procedure are documented on the internal page here:

wiki page, tahaf-tajog: https://jira.ordindyn.corp/pipeline